I Cannot Tell It All

I married young after dropping out of school in the seventh grade. I had two sons, and with no real work experience, I floated along and did what I wanted to do.

Admittedly, my life was a mess. I knew I needed God, and I received Him in 1980, but I wasn’t ready to truly follow Him then.

Eventually, I earned my GED, went on to graduate from college and got into the medical field. I’ve been a registered nurse now for 14 years.

In 2003, I rededicated my life to God, and this time I began following Him. I started to believe that the Father had a unique plan for which He was preparing me, although I did not know what it was.


I began to understand that I am “fearfully and wonderfully made” (Ps. 139:14, NKJV), and that no matter what I had done, I am forgiven and loved. Even though I’d felt forsaken before, God was with me. In October 2003, He spoke to me and revealed to me what He wanted me to do.

God directed me to start a business for which He gave me the name, Scripture Scrubs. I was to manufacture and sell professional apparel for doctors, nurses, dentists and others—medical uniform tops on which would be written the Word of God and spiritual messages.

I did not feel worthy of this venture, nor did I have the kind of experience necessary to run such a business. I am a nurse, a wife, a mother and a grandmother. I live in a very small American town. I still wonder, Why would the Father choose me?

I know that all the hardships of my life were preparation for this time. Scripture Scrubs has been such a blessing. The products are sold over the Internet, and the response has been supernatural at times.


God is continuing to teach me to persevere in faith and to wait on Him. I can see how my past is fitting into the future He has for me.

It is great to realize that God can choose to pour out His love and blessings on someone like me. I give all praise to the Father for what He has done.
